Revenue Ruling 2010-6 provides various prescribed rates for federal income tax purposes for February 2010 (current month) including the applicable federal interest rates, the adjusted applicable federal interest rates, the adjusted federal long-term rate, the adjusted federal long-term tax-exempt rate. These rates are determined as prescribed by section 1274.
The section 7520 rate is 3.4 percent.
